Crash Hot Potatoes (Sam Style) - easy


What We Used:
  • 1 small bag young red potatoes, skin on
  • coarse salt
  • roasted peppers and garlic ( premade spice in a bottle )
  • grapeseed oil
Boil the potatoes till they're tender but not too mushy. Oil a pan generously once they're finished and break out the potato masher!

Put the potatoes on the pan one at a time and mush them down, but don't mush too much, you're just trying to flatten them a bit. Once you're done pressing them, grab your salt and whatever spices you wish to use and sprinkle on top of the potatoes.

Finish with more oil and bake them in the oven at 400 until they're golden and crispy.


Beer Battered Cod - Intermediate (for deep frying action)

What We Used
  • 1 package of cod
  • 1 to 1 1/2 cup of Guinness ( you can use whatever type of beer you'd like, this is what we had )
  • 1 cup fl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t, garlic powder, onion powder, black pepper
  • 1 egg
Put the flour, spices and egg in a bowl and mix together a bit. Add in the Guinness until you've got the right consistancy. I cut the bits of cod we had in half since they were REALLY long.

Heat oil in a pan ( We used the Mok Wok ) and then dip pieces of cod in the batter and pop them into the hot oil until they're crispy and golden! Voila!
